Jack Jackson, Jr. “Big Jack”
Des Moines
Jack Jackson, Jr., “Big Jack,” was born January 1, 1955 in Des Moines, Iowa to Jack Jackson, Sr. and Minnie (Lowery) Jackson. He passed away Monday, June 13, 2016.
Jack is survived by his wife, Raedean; son, Raymond Small; step-children, Michael Small, Michelle Small, Nicholas Small, Joe Spencer, A.J. Hill, and Shareve Spencer; step-father, Ollie Talton, Sr.; siblings, Terry Jackson Myers, Clifford Jackson, Winifred Jackson, Alice Talton, Florine Talton, and Lorna Talton; nieces and nephews, Cortez, Buddy, Terysha, Tony, Stephanie, Sami, Ollie, Shelby, Solomon, Chelsea, Ollisha, John Luke, Piere, Isiah, Nicholas, and Zach; as well as numerous grandchildren and other loving family members.
He was preceded in death by his parents, Jack Jackson, Sr. and Minnie Lowery Jackson; brother, Ollie Talton, Jr.; and his nephews, Eddie Mitchell, Jr. and T. Andre Talton.
Jack was a great dancer, a wonderful story-teller, and could always make people laugh. He was a kind and giving person and will be remembered as a “gentle giant.” Jack was a fierce defender of his family, especially his sisters. He worked at Mercy Hospital and was a firm believer in God. He will be missed by all who knew him.
